There are several options for getting from Sacramento to Philadelphia by train, bus and car. The cheapest option is to take the bus which costs around $380 and will take around 2 days 22h. If you need to get there more quickly, you can drive and arrive in approximately 1 day 19h, though it is a bit more costly at approximately $275.
The distance between Sacramento and Philadelphia is around 2,789 miles (4,488km). In a direct line (as the crow flies), the distance is 2,452 miles (3,946km)
It takes around 2 days 20h to get from Sacramento and Philadelphia by train. If you are travelling by car it will take around 1 day 19h to drive there.
The quickest way to get from Sacramento to Philadelphia is to drive which takes around 1 day 19h and will set you back approx $275.
The cheapest way to travel between Sacramento and Philadelphia, if you exclude driving, is to take the bus which will typically cost around $380 for a standard one-way ticket.
Yes there is a train service that runs between Sacramento and Philadelphia. It typically takes around 2 days 20h and departs once daily.
There are no direct train services that runs from Sacramento to Philadelphia. However, you can instead can take several connecting trains with a changeover in Chicago Union Station, Rockville Amtrak and UNION STATION station. These services run once daily and will take a minimum of 2 days 20h.
Amtrak, Amtrak Acela Express and Amtrak Northeast Regional run train services between Sacramento and Philadelphia. Trains depart once daily and will take around 2 days 20h, however, this may vary depending on the particular service and whether it runs express or stops all stations.
Yes there is a bus that runs regularly from Sacramento and Philadelphia. It typically takes around 2 days 22h and departs 6 times a week.
There are no direct bus services that runs from Sacramento to Philadelphia. However, you can instead can take several connecting buses with changeovers in Oakland, Las Vegas Downtown and NB Main after Fremont. These services run 6 times a week and will take a minimum of 2 days 22h.
Flixbus USA and Greyhound USA run regular bus services between Sacramento and Philadelphia. Buses run 6 times a week and take around 2 days 22h on average but will vary depending on you book with.
